Technical Field
The utility model relates to a new and old road bed concrete panel in road surface links up construction technical field, specifically is a new and old road surface links up pull rod reinforcing bar and plants muscle equipment of holing.
Background
Along with the development of construction engineering, the new and old road surfaces are widened and paved by utilizing a design concept and are widely applied to road construction in China, the main method for drilling holes by connecting the tie bars and the steel bars on the road surfaces at present is to drill holes by manually holding a percussion drill for steel bar planting, the construction method has certain limitation, does not have the functions of strong flexibility and rapid and convenient installation speed, cannot ensure the accuracy of the position of the tie bars and the steel bars, has long process duration and high production cost, improves the labor intensity of manpower, complicates the construction process and reduces the working efficiency.

In order to achieve the above object, the utility model provides a following technical scheme: the utility model provides a new and old road surface links up pull rod reinforcing bar planting bar equipment of holing, includes support and sliding platform, the equal fixedly connected with supporting steel plate in front and the rear side at support top, the spout has been seted up to the relative one side of supporting steel plate, sliding platform's the front and the equal fixedly connected with slide bar in the back, the slide bar is close to the one end of spout run through to the inner chamber of spout and with spout sliding connection, the fixed fixture of left side fixedly connected with U type at sliding platform top, the right side fixed connection riser fixture at sliding platform top, the right side fixed connection handle at sliding platform top.
Preferably, the support and the support steel plate are both made of 2cm by 3cm square steel, the support steel plate is 1.2m long, and the support is 0.3m wide.
Preferably, the sliding platform comprises a thick steel plate, a thin steel plate is fixedly connected to the top of the thick steel plate, the thickness of the thick steel plate is 1cm, the thickness of the thin steel plate is 3mm, the lengths of the thick steel plate and the thin steel plate are both 60cm, and the widths of the thick steel plate and the thin steel plate are both 30 cm.
Preferably, the U-shaped fixing clamp is made of phi 20 deformed steel bars, and the U-shaped fixing clamp is welded with the sliding platform.
Preferably, the handle is U-shaped, and the surface of the handle is provided with anti-skid lines.

Construction method of new and old pavement connection tie rod steel bar planting drilling equipment
A: the device comprises a support 1, a supporting steel plate 3 and a sliding platform 2, wherein the support 1 and the supporting steel plate 3 are both made of 2cm 3cm square steel, the supporting steel plate 3 is 1.2m long, the support 1 is 0.3m wide, the sliding platform 2 is made of a thick steel plate and a thin steel plate, the thickness of the thick steel plate is 1cm, the thickness of the thin steel plate is 3mm, the lengths of the thick steel plate and the thin steel plate are both 60cm, the widths of the thick steel plate and the thin steel plate are both 30cm, the left side of the top of the sliding platform 2 is fixedly connected with a U-shaped fixing clamp 6, the U-shaped fixing clamp 6 is welded with the platform by a phi 20 deformed steel bar, and welding personnel can be certified after professional training in the device processing process so as to ensure that the structure size;
b: a measurer accurately marks the approach of the position of the steel bar of the pull rod according to a design drawing, a field operator places drilling equipment according to the drilling position, the top surface of the water-stable base layer is leveled before installation, the drilling equipment is ensured to be installed stably and firmly, the height of the drilling equipment is actually adjusted according to the field, and the height of the drilling position is ensured to meet the design requirement;
c: the operator operates to drill a hole;
d: after drilling, hole cleaning inspection is carried out, and whether the hole position height and the hole position depth meet requirements or not is mainly inspected;
e: after the hole site inspection is finished, the operating personnel drives in bar planting glue and installs the pull rod steel bars;
f: after the pull rod steel bars are installed, the machine moves, and construction is carried out in the next hole position.
